A growing fashion comparison has been going on for years between the Met Gala and the AMVCA.

Viewers have consistently sparked heated conversations around the red carpet styles of both events, with many now asking: Is the Met Gala still a match for the AMVCA?

This year, the spotlight returned to the red carpet once again. The 12th edition of the Africa Magic Viewers’ Choice Awards (AMVCA), held on May 9, 2026, at Eko Hotel and Suites in Lagos, delivered glamorous moments, surprise victories, and looks that dominated social media for days.

The Met Gala 2026, which took place the same week (before the AMVCA, May 4), featured the exhibition theme “Costume Art” and the dress code “Fashion is Art.”

While it remains the global benchmark for high fashion, many observers felt the AMVCA delivered stronger impact and creativity.

The comparison is not new. For years, people have highlighted the fashion at the AMVCA, especially because both events occur around the same time.

As African designers gain more global recognition, the AMVCA red carpet is no longer just a local affair, it’s a bold statement to the world.

The AMVCA stood out with its celebration of African creativity through detailed handwork, bold silhouettes, cultural storytelling, and architectural designs. Many attendees opted for indigenous haute couture, showcasing excellence and heritage on a grand scale. The Cultural Night further amplified this with magnificent ancestral-inspired looks.

Social media reactions were electric as users complimented the fashion creativity and elegance.

One user declared, “AMVCA fashion is better than the Met Gala.”

Another user said, “This is the real Met Gala,” praising Nigerian fashion designers, a user said; “Nigerian designers ate and left no crumbs.”

Many praised the craftsmanship, noting that African stars “broke the internet without being naked.”

International viewers expressed surprise at the level of creativity, with some asking why the Met Gala couldn’t match the energy. While opinions varied, the volume of praise for AMVCA’s originality and elegance was undeniable.
